[L14XS] Red Skull Locations [04] Upgrade Locations [05] Weapon Locations [06] _______________________________________________________________________________ Version History [01]----------------------------------------------------------- _______________________________________________________________________________ -2010 2 Nov. - Walkthrough Accepted, Level 1-3 completed 6 Nov. - Walkthrough Level 4-9 completed 26 Nov. - Walkthrough Level 10-14 completed 26 Nov. - Version 1 Completed _______________________________________________________________________________ FAQ Notes [02]----------------------------------------------------------------- _______________________________________________________________________________ Camera - In Lara Croft and the Guardian of Light, the camera has a fixed view. Almost every level in the game is set on a specific view. Throughout the walkthrough I use compass directions to guide you. Most of these are the four secondary directions, Northwest, Northeast, Southeast, Southwest that represent the general path you can take based on the camera angle. Speed Run - There's no real secret to achieving the timed objectives on each level. General tips include equipping the end of the game items that boost all your attributes, rolling instead of running (Slightly faster) and ignoring instead of fighting enemies whenever you can. In the walkthrough I'll point out a few places to reduce your time when I come across them. _______________________________________________________________________________ Single Player Campaign [03]---------------------------------------------------- _______________________________________________________________________________ The single player campaign of Lara Croft and the Guardian of Light is short and features Lara searching for a mysterious mirror. When mercenaries remove the mirror, they release the evil demon Xolotl who takes the mirror and prepares to summon an army of creatures to conquer the world. At the same time the Guardian of Light, Totec, is awoken and together he and Lara struggle to return the mirror and defeat Xolotl. This is all you need to know about the story which is not really important. In the single player campaign, Totec gives Lara his golden spear and takes a separate path leaving Lara to make her way alone. In the co-op campaign, Lara and Totec work together to chase Xolotl. _______________________________________________________________________________ Level 1: Temple of Light [L1ToL]----------------------------------------------- _______________________________________________________________________________ ------------------------------------------------------------ Score Challenges: ------------------------------------------------------------ 100,000 Points 130,000 Points 160,000 Points (Magnums) ------------------------------------------------------------ Reward Challenges: ------------------------------------------------------------ Collect 10 Red Skulls ......................................... Boss Battle: T-Rex There's not a lot of strategy in this battle. The way you're directed to kill the T-Rex is to lead him over each of the 3 spiked traps in the NW, NE and SE corners of the map. You activate them by pressure, and by switch. At the same time you need to fend off other enemies. The real trick is to complete the Reward and Score Challenges. To knock down the columns you can let the T-Rex destroy them or use your mines to blow them up. ------------------------------------------------------------ Red Skull Locations: ------------------------------------------------------------ Red Skull #1 - Run to the right of your starting point. Across the stream near the east wall the Red Skull is under some trees. Red Skull #2 - Near the ammo cache on the west side. Red Skull #3 - South of the ammo cache near #2, on an island in the river. Red Skull #4 - Go north from the ammo cache until you see two trees near each other. Red Skull #4 is between the two trees under a truck you must destroy. Red Skull #5 - Just south of the switch in the W-NW area. You must blow up a column to find it. Red Skull #6 - Head north from the circular stone platform where the T-Rex spawned. The skull is hidden under a column on your right. Red Skull #7 - Go north from #4 to see Red Skull #5 at the top of the stairs. Red Skull #8 - Under a column just to the NW of the spiky floor panels in the NE part of the area. Red Skull #9 - In the middle of the spiky floor panels by #8 Red Skull #10 - Near the ammo cache north of#8 and #9. It is hidden under the trucks so blow them up to find it. trucks to see it. To obtain the points challenge, focus on the enemies that spawn around the T-Rex after you whittle its life away some. The thing you need to do is kill the enemies while dodging the T-Rex. The real points come when you kill things while your Relic power meter is full. Remember, using the spear knocks down the enery shooting enemies. If you run up the stairs to the NW and NE you will trigger a small flood of spiders. If you kill them with a full Relic Meter you can obtain a lot of points. If you want to kill the T-Rex in 2 minutes, return on a later play-through and use the rocket launcher. _______________________________________________________________________________ Level 5: Forgotten Gate [L5FG]------------------------------------------------- _______________________________________________________________________________ ------------------------------------------------------------ Score Challenges: ------------------------------------------------------------ 140,000 Points 170,000 Points 230,000 Points (Double Barrel Shotgun) ------------------------------------------------------------ Reward Challenges: ------------------------------------------------------------ Collection 10 Red Skulls .............................. This boss battle is divided into 3 stages. ------------------------------------------------------------ Achieving the Score and Reward Challenges: ------------------------------------------------------------ Points: If you are trying to get the point value achievement I ignore Xolotl and just kill spiders in stage 1. If you don't hit him he will just keep summoning them until you can work up to needed point values. While you can make up points in future stages, this is the only place where there are infinite enemies. The first time I tried, I missed my goal by 900 points. Time: If you avoid dying, it's possible to gain 140,000 points and defeat Xolotl within 10:00 minutes. Getting the point total in the first stage nets you the Spear of Light. If you have both Jade Hearts and the Mask of Xolotl from the Speed Run of level 13, it will only take two hits to deplete his lifebar. You can also use the railgun. Ignore damage and focus on hitting Xolotl when he appears in stages 2 and 3. One hit with the Spear of Light will also kill the lava giants that appear. ------------------------------------------------------------ Boss Battle: Xolotl ------------------------------------------------------------ Jump the gap to initiate the battle. ------------------------------------------------------------ Stage 1: Spiked Floor Panels ------------------------------------------------------------ Xolotl will stand on the platforms on the sides of the area and there is giant spiky pillar blocking the way forward. There is no single safe spot--you must keep moving to stay alive. Look for the blue circles, they telegraph where the spikes will shoot up so just stand on a panel without a blue circle. It helps to equip speed boosting items. Shoot Xolotl with the spear or other ranged weapon after his life bar appears. After working away his life bars he will change his battle tactics. Here he will summon a bunch of spiders to attack you. Follow the path to an ammo cache and healing fountain and continue on to a platform with poisonous pods. ------------------------------------------------------------ Stage 2: Poisonous Plants ------------------------------------------------------------ At the start of this battle, Xolotl will emerge from a shadowy portal (of evil) where you are standing causing a an area-attack shockwave. To avoid getting hit by Xolotl just keep moving and he will always appear a few steps behind you. As soon as you are at a safe distance from the shockwave, turn and attack Xolotl with any weapon you care to use. Rapid-fire works better because he doesn't stay in one place long, but I have beat him with only the basic Totec Spear. The trick is to turn and fire then keep moving so he doesn't land on you. After depleting his life bar, Xolotl will summon skeletons lizards and even one of the large poison shooting enemies while continuing to emerge from the portals. Continue to run and gun to deplete his second lifebar. Note: Even if you don't hit Xolotl with anything, his shockwave will usually hit the poisonous plants causing them to rupture and injuring him. Thus even if you just defend yourself he will eventually injure himself enough to deplete his entire lifebar and flee. Follow Xolotl to another healing fountain and ammo cache then jump down the stairs to reach the final area. ------------------------------------------------------------ Stage 3: Lava Pit ------------------------------------------------------------ Xolotl will appear on a ledge to the NW in a cutscene. The battle will start with a huge rain of fiery rocks. Dodge them and run to the stairway that is closet to the platform. Xolotl will appear there while fiery rocks are flung around. Hit him as hard as you can before he leaps up and another huge rain of fire falls down until you deplete his lifebar. Now the giant lava monsters will start climbing out of the lava at you. This is where you need to guard your ammo as there are between 6-10 of them that emerge two at a time. There is ammo and health packs on the platform and the monsters themselves drop them. If you run out of ammo, you can kill these guys with the spear but it takes a very long time. Xolotl will appear on the platform to the SE that you jumped off of to reach the level. You cannot hit him here so just wait. Another big rain of firey rocks will fall on the platform just keep running around dodging them. They tend to follow you so I usually run clockwise around the platform to avoid them. Xolotl will now begin appear and try and attack you similar to how he did in stage 2 while the rocks continue to fall. Once you deplete about half his life bar he will go to the center of the platform and shoot energy blasts in all directions at you. If you have sufficient life left just stand in one spot and blast him with the most powerful weapon you have at hand. When you deplete his lifebar this time, he will fall over and the ending cutscene will play. Note: To beat the reward Challenge "Defeat Xolotl in 10:00 or Less" you should get the Spear of Light from the point totals challenge. If you use the Spear of Light, it only takes 2-3 hits to deplete his lifebar so you can dispatch him very quickly. Other than that, just try not to die in the spikes and you should have no trouble beating him in time. Congratulations!
